Description

'Gaypet Flea Tick Powder For Dogs And Cats' is an insecticide and miticide. Its Federal EPA registration number is: 410-76. It was originally approved by EPA on 26 Apr 1973. Its registration got cancelled on 31 Dec 1987. It has a 'Caution' signal word. It has the following active ingredients: Carbaryl. It's approved for 10 sites including cat bedding, cat living quarters, cat sleeping quarters, cats, dog bedding, dog houses, dog kennels, dog living quarters, dog sleeping quarters, and dogs. It is also approved for 3 pests and pest groups including but not limited to brown dog tick, fleas, and ticks.
